CIE TN 007:2017
Interim Recommendation for Practical Application of the CIE System for Mesopic Photometry in Outdoor Lighting

Scope
Technical Note defining the method for calculating the adaptation coefficient used with the mesopic photometry equations of CIE 191:2010, and the associated mesopic quantities. Intended to be applicable to outdoor lighting for drivers, motorcyclists, cyclists, and pedestrians; not applicable to aviation or maritime lighting (14 pages, freely downloadable).
